Coryell County, Texas, offers a serene environment ideal for seniors in a memory care facility, featuring engaging community programs and accessible resources tailored to their needs. The county is home to the Central Texas Veterans Health Care System, which provides specialized services for veteran seniors, while the Coryell County Senior Center hosts regular activities and events that foster connection and socialization among older adults. Scenic parks like the Pidcoke Park not only provide beautiful outdoor spaces for relaxation but also organize walking groups specifically designed to encourage gentle exercise among elderly residents. With its focus on health and wellness, Coryell County promotes a vibrant lifestyle for seniors residing in memory care facilities.
